In an experiment, m grams of a compound X (gas/liquid/solid) taken in a container is loaded in a balance as shown in figure I below. In the presence of a magnetic field, the pan with X is either deflected upwards (figure II), or deflected downwards (figure III), depending on the compound X. Identify the correct statement(s).


- If X is H2O(l), deflection of the pan is upwards.
- If X is K4[Fe(CN)6](s), deflection of the pan is upwards.
- If X is O2(g), deflection of the pan is downwards.
- If X is C6H6
Answer
(C) If X is O 2( g ) , deflection of the pan is downwards.
